WebSteps for Laying Artificial Turf. When you’re ready to lay the artificial turf, unroll it and let it set in the sun for half a day. This allows the roll to acclimate, a helpful pre-installation step. Next, carefully rough-cut the turf with a razor knife to fit the dimensions, leaving a little extra for final adjustments, and secure it in place. Trial by ordeal was an ancient judicial practice by which the guilt or innocence of the accused was determined by subjecting them to a painful, or at least an unpleasant, usually dangerous experience. In medieval Europe, like trial by combat, trial by ordeal, such as cruentation, was sometimes considered a "judgement of God" (Latin: … Trial by ordeal was an ancient judicial practice by which the guilt or innocence of the accused was determined by subjecting them to a painful, or at least an unpleasant, usually dangerous experience.
